What's Happening?
FX's acclaimed series 'The Bear' is set to return for its fifth and final season. The show, which has garnered significant attention and accolades, will release all eight episodes on June 25 on Hulu and internationally on Disney Plus. For cable viewers,
FX will air the first two episodes, with subsequent episodes released weekly until the series finale on August 6. The storyline picks up after the dramatic conclusion of Season 4, where Carmy, played by Jeremy Allen White, exits the restaurant business, leaving Sydney and Sugar to manage the struggling establishment. The series continues its quest for a Michelin star, promising high stakes and intense drama. Returning cast members include Lionel Boyce, Liza Colón-Zayas, Matty Matheson, and Jamie Lee Curtis.
